Output 5458a8182eaa5f9a324c723ea986a31a66dc51c8a621ab20e9cdb543e0079239:0

value
18570909
script pubkey
OP_0 OP_PUSHBYTES_20 a0fc6d504acc49555132c37837630688b928002f
address
ltc1q5r7x65z2e3y425fjcdurwccx3zujsqp0xptpfv
transaction
5458a8182eaa5f9a324c723ea986a31a66dc51c8a621ab20e9cdb543e0079239
spent
true